Essential Functions
  • The MRI Technologist operates the Magnetic Resonance operations at SimonMed Imaging centers.
  • Knowledge of magnetic resonance imaging procedures and technology
  • Operates a magnetic resonance scanner to obtain images used by physicians in the diagnosis and treatment of pathologies
  • Selects appropriate imaging techniques, and operates console and peripheral hardware; enters and monitors patient data, transfers images from disk to magnetic media to produce the transparency, and develops film in automatic processor
  • Obtains images, produces film records and backups from disk to storage media, and transfers from desk to PACS stations
  • Maintains accurate study documentation
